About the University of Illinois Chicago

UIC is among the nation's preeminent urban public research universities, a Carnegie RU/VH research institution, and the largest university in Chicago. UIC serves over 34,000 students, comprising one of the most diverse student bodies in the nation and is designated as a Minority Serving Institution (MSI), an Asian American and Native American Pacific Islander Serving Institution (AANAPSI) and a Hispanic Serving Institution (HSI). Through its 16 colleges, UIC produces nationally and internationally recognized multidisciplinary academic programs in concert with civic, corporate and community partners worldwide, including a full complement of health sciences colleges.

By emphasizing cutting-edge and transformational research along with a commitment to the success of all students, UIC embodies the dynamic, vibrant and engaged urban university. Recent "Best Colleges" rankings published by U.S. News & World Report, found UIC climbed up in its rankings among top public schools in the nation and among all national universities. UIC has nearly 260,000 alumni, and is one of the largest employers in the city of Chicago.

Description:

The Allergy and Immunology section of the Division of Pulmonary, Critical Care, Sleep & Allergy at the University of Illinois Chicago/UI Health is looking for a full-time academic allergist-immunologist for a clinical position. This position is predominantly adult-focused.

The University of Illinois Hospital & Health Sciences System (UI Health) encompasses a 455-bed tertiary care hospital, 26 outpatient clinics, and 13 Mile Square Health Center facilities (Federally Qualified Health Centers). Our mission is "to advance health for everyone through outstanding clinical care, education, research, and social responsibility" of all Illinoisans. These are wrapped into our I CARE values of Inclusion, Compassion, Accountability, Respect and Excellence. (hospital.uillinois.edu)

Duties & Responsibilities:

1.Practice clinical Allergy and Immunology through outpatient and inpatient consultation at the UI Health/University of Illinois at Chicago and the Jesse Brown Veterans Affairs Hospital.

2.Teach pulmonary fellows, residents, and medical students through didactic lectures and through their clinical rotations.

3.Perform Allergy Procedures including:

a. Drug Allergy and Skin Testing Evaluations

b. Drug Desensitization

c. Oral Food Challenges

d. Drug Challenges

e. Skin testing: aeroallergens and foods

f. Delayed hypersensitivity Testing/Patch Testing

g. Allergen immunotherapy (aeroallergen, venom)

h. Biologics Administration and Monitoring

i. Prescribe specialty medications for the treatment of immunodeficiency and hereditary angioedema.

4.Work within a team to ensure high quality care to complex historically marginalized populations which may include facilitating hospital protocols and clinic workflows to improve provider, staff, and patient satisfaction.

5.Perform other related duties and participate in special projects, as assigned.

Qualifications:

Must have the following prior to start of employment:

1.Medical Doctorate (MD) or equivalent; AND

2.Completed an ACGME-accredited Allergy/Immunology Fellowship Training program; AND

3.Be Board Certified/Board Eligible by the American Board of Allergy Immunology (ABAI); AND

4.Have or be eligible for a State of Illinois physician license.

Preferred Qualifications:

1.Experience in conducting health services, clinical and/or translational research.

2.Fluency in Spanish (spoken, reading and writing)
